    Quick Answer

    Traditional biblical interpretation holds that sexual intimacy is designed for marriage between a man and a woman, based on Genesis 2 and multiple New Testament passages.

    "Therefore shall a man leave his father and his mother, and shall cleave unto his wife: and they shall be one flesh." Genesis 2:24 (KJV)
